The door sweep is a component of weatherstripping that helps with energy efficiency and also prevents the infiltration of water or air between the sill of the door and the threshold. It is situated on the bottom of the patio door. The sweeps get worn out over time and might need to be replaced. It is crucial to replace your door sweeps periodically to ensure that they are providing the proper seals for your home.

To install the new door sweep, first open the patio door and then remove the old one from underneath. This task could require a utility blade or needle-nosed pliers. Make use of a tape measure to determine the length of the new sweep you require. You should have enough to allow the sweep to sweep the floor or the top of your threshold lightly. The sweep should also be able to move in and out easily.

If the sweep is too tight against the threshold, it will wear quickly. You can loosen the screws on the hinge to see if this helps fix the issue, or lower your adjustable top strip on the threshold to allow the sweep some space. If the door is too saggy it could scratch and tear the sweep. If this happens, you can tighten the hinge screws or make the jambs shimmy to prevent this from happening.
